How Far? (Gorillaz song)

"How Far?" is a song by British virtual band Gorillaz, featuring Tony Allen & Skepta. The track was released on 2 May 2020 without any prior announcement as the fourth single for the first season of Gorillaz's Song Machine project, which involves the ongoing release of various Gorillaz tracks featuring previously unannounced guest musicians over the course of 2020. The single marks the first posthumously released material featuring Tony Allen.

Background

"How Far?" was written and recorded in the weeks prior to lockdown as a result of the Covid-19 pandemic.[1]

On 30 April, 2020, Tony Allen, an afrobeat drummer featured on the song, died of abdominal aortic aneurysm at the age of 79.[2] Allen had previously worked with Gorillaz founder, Damon Albarn, through a band called The Good, the Bad & the Queen, where both participated as members through the early 2000's.[3]

Without any prior announcement, "How Far?" released a few days later on 2 May 2020, as a standalone audio with no accompanying video or episodic EP like other Song Machine releases. According to a press release, the song was released as an official tribute to Allen.[4]

Personnel

Gorillaz

  • Damon Albarn – vocals, instrumentation, songwriting, director, music producer
  • Jamie Hewlett – artwork, character design, video direction
  • Remi Kabaka Jr. – drum programming, percussion, live drums, music producer, A&R

Additional musicians

  • Tony Allen – vocals, drums, songwriting
  • Skepta – vocals
  • Konoto Sato – violin
  • Stella Page – violin
  • Ciara Ismail – violin
  • Isabelle Dunn – violin

Technical

  • Stephen Sedgwick – mixing, engineering
  • Samuel Egglenton – mixing, engineering
  • John Davis – mastering, engineering
